Overview of the ALP Post:

The Assistant Loco Pilot (ALP) plays a crucial role in ensuring the smooth operation of trains across the vast railway network of India. From assisting in the driving of trains to maintaining the locomotives, the ALP position is both challenging and rewarding. As we look forward to the 2024 recruitment cycle, let's delve into what you can expect from this prestigious position.

Key Responsibilities:

  1. Train Operation: ALPs are responsible for assisting locomotive drivers in the safe and efficient operation of trains.

  2. Maintenance: Ensuring the proper maintenance and inspection of locomotives to uphold safety standards.

  3. Emergency Response: Quick thinking and prompt action in case of emergencies or technical issues.

  4. Coordination: Collaborating with other railway staff to ensure the timely and smooth functioning of train services.

Eligibility Criteria:

While specific eligibility criteria may be outlined in the official notification, typical requirements for the ALP post include educational qualifications such as a diploma or degree in engineering, age limits, and certain medical fitness standards.
